Madalena
/M-AA-D-AA-L-EH-N-AA/
Of Magdala (Portuguese form) — Madalena (Portuguese, from Greek Magdalēnē 'woman of Magdala') is the Portuguese form of Magdalene/Magdalena. Honors Mary Magdalene, the New Testament disciple. The Madalena form is iconically Portuguese-Brazilian — the Portuguese single-l spelling distinguishes from Spanish/Italian double-l (Magdalena/Maddalena).
